Output 2dfaaa63e222fd66eecfa777c152f063431bfa9f44cf1bf2dcf143fc36226d3a:1

value
2002810
script pubkey
OP_0 OP_PUSHBYTES_20 150ec5b7fe1de8fccd5aa28de5b3488bbc6b328f
address
bc1qz58vtdl7rh50en2652x7tv6g3w7xkv50dq2djw
transaction
2dfaaa63e222fd66eecfa777c152f063431bfa9f44cf1bf2dcf143fc36226d3a
spent
true